Music Education for New Parents: Join a team of students creating music education and music therapy workshops for new parents in New Brunswick.
New Jersey Prison Outreach Project: Join a team of students working together to bring educational opportunities to incarcerated people in the state.
Project R.E.V.E.A.L: Professor Brittney Cooper: Join a team of students archiving information and documents pertaining to reproductive health. This project is recommended for students interested in reproductive justice, public health, coding, archives, and library science. Together, you will help Dr. Brittney Cooper and a team of Rutgers experts build a public archive.
The Douglass Honors College Faculty Fellows Cohort: This cohort will work directly with a Rutgers faculty member on an interdisciplinary project in public policy. PREREQUISITE: participants must be Honors College Students.
The Pronouns Project, Professor Carlos Decena (SPRING 2027 ONLY): work as part of a team conducting a survey to learn about trans students' experiences at Rutgers and develop resources on best practices for supporting trans and nonbinary students.
